2008 SESSION
HB 1486 Dealer permits; local ordinances pertaining to real estate taxes for euthanizing companion animals.
Introduced by: Clifford L. Athey, Jr. | all patrons ... notes | add to my profiles
SUMMARY AS INTRODUCED:
Dealer permits. Allows localities to charge dealers in companion animals up to $150 to obtain a permit. The current limit for such a permit is $50. The bill also requires localities that use the proceeds from real estate taxes to fund animal control activities or has releasing agencies that euthanize companion animals that are not critically ill or exhibit behavior that is a risk to their caretakers to obtain a permit.
